Output afba5d960e5c9a3afc8a45b55b778d63bb2d68d41e3db8ab468264ad362a9e20:2

value
445923572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fb50f7c44449704eeada52cb66e6a16d5775c6f OP_EQUAL
address
3KAftVBgVfCWmsvX7RM8yRrg2nqJ5uFwnT
transaction
afba5d960e5c9a3afc8a45b55b778d63bb2d68d41e3db8ab468264ad362a9e20
spent
true